East Renfrewshire Council has submitted £23 million plans to build five new nurseries in the region. The facilities, three of which will operate as family centres providing childcare for 50 weeks of the year, are planned to be open by August 2020.

Bryan Wilson Property developer London & Scottish Investments (L&SI) has unveiled plans to create around 100 new jobs in Barrhead by transforming the derelict Nestle dog food factory site in Glasgow Road into a state of the art retail park.

Work to build a new £3.8 million business centre, which is being developed by East Renfrewshire Council, is now underway. The project, which will create Greenlaw Business Centre in Newton Mearns, will enable the council to increase its support for small businesses.
